Q. The mixture of $CO$ and $CO_2$ contains $60% \,CO$ and rest is $CO_2$. Two liters of this mixture is passed over red hot charcoal. What is the volume of mixture after reaction

Solution:

Volume of $CO = \frac{60}{100} \times2 = 1.2L$
Volume of $CO_{2} = \frac{40}{100} \times 2 = 0.8L$
$CO_{2} + 2C \to 2CO$
$0.8 \,L \,CO_{2}$ produces $= 1.6\, L$ of $Co$
Volume of mixture after the reaction
$= 1.6\,+\, 1.2 = 2.8\, L$
